Loose Hinges Unlike traditional closet doors, bifold doors are hinged in the middle and fold in a way that maximizes space. They offer a variety of advantages, but they can also become problematic when the hardware starts to wear out or if doors begin falling off of their tracks. These issues can be resolved with a few DIY solutions and troubleshooting strategies. Bifold doors may have issues with sagging or scraping the floor, or getting pulled off their tracks by winds or children playing inside. This is caused by the door's alignment being off, and can be repaired in only a few steps. The first step is removing the set screw from each hinge, both at the top and bottom. After loosening the screws ensure that the doors are level against the frame. You can adjust the screw to raise the door if the doors are sliding. This will prevent the doors from colliding with the floor and will allow them to close properly. If the issue continues You can also try to raise the doors by adjusting the bottom pivot pin or guide wheel. Be careful not to tighten too much the wheels or you could damage the hardware. You may also find that the hinges have damaged in the wood where they attach to the door. This can be caused by normal use over time, or changes in humidity.
